When considering how to choose on a pool fence, safety is often the top priority. Pool fences function a crucial barrier, defending youngsters and pets from the dangers of unsupervised pool access. It's essential to select a fence that not solely looks good but effectively retains your family members safe.






One of the first factors to keep in mind is the kind of materials you need to use. Pool fences are available in various materials, similar to aluminum, wooden, vinyl, and glass. Each materials has its execs and cons. Aluminum is sturdy and rust-resistant, making it a popular selection for lots of homeowners. Wood can provide a conventional look and may be painted or stained to match your home’s aesthetics, but it may require regular maintenance.

The height of the fence is one other crucial consideration. Most safety guidelines recommend that pool fences be no less than four feet tall to reduce the risk of youngsters climbing over. The top of the fence should be freed from any handholds or footholds to discourage climbing. If your property has varying elevations, you’ll want to ensure the fence design accommodates those adjustments to take care of safety.

In addition to height, the spacing between vertical slats or bars is an important safety characteristic. The gaps must be narrow enough to forestall a toddler from slipping via but also designed to ensure visibility. The general guideline is that the spacing shouldn't exceed four inches. This ensures that young children and pets are stored safely away from the pool area.


Another issue to suppose about is how you need the gate to operate. The gate should always be self-closing and self-latching. A well-functioning gate is essential for the effectiveness of the fence as a safety barrier. A gate that doesn’t shut correctly can compromise the integrity of the fence entirely. Make certain the latch is out of attain of small children, to prevent any unauthorized access.


Local regulations may dictate specific standards for pool fences. Before making any purchases, it's wise to check along with your local building authority or homeowners’ association. They may have guidelines relating to height, material, and different features that must be adhered to. Following these tips not only keeps your property compliant with native laws however ensures that safety is prioritized.

Materials similar to aluminum, mesh, glass, and vinyl are in style for pool fences. Aluminum and mesh are sturdy and effective in preventing access, whereas glass provides an unobstructed view. Choose materials that meet safety standards and are weather-resistant for long-term use.


How tall should a pool fence be?


A pool fence ought to ideally be a minimal of 4 feet tall to successfully deter young kids and pets. Local constructing codes could specify minimal heights, so it's essential to check regulations in your space to ensure compliance.

Do I want a self-closing gate for my pool fence?


Yes, a self-closing and self-latching gate is extremely beneficial for pool safety. It ensures the gate closes automatically behind anyone exiting or entering the pool area, decreasing the risk of unintended access.

How typically should I inspect my pool fence?


Regular inspections of your pool fence ought to be performed no less than twice a 12 months. Check for any harm, unfastened posts, or gaps that would compromise safety, and address issues promptly to maintain a safe environment.
